Android 人脸检测备选方案

Android face detection alternatives

我已经使用 Android 的 Camera.FaceDetectionListener(在 Android Developers guide 之后)在我的应用程序中成功实现了人脸检测,但不幸的是有些设备不支持此功能。有没有其他方法可以达到同样的效果?

平时用OpenCV做图像处理算法。

http://opencv.org/platforms/android.html

它的算法比Android人脸检测要好得多,而且如果你下载SDK你有一个人脸检测例子。

下载地址如下:

http://opencv.org/downloads.html

SDK,处理相机 api 2,它以 30 fps 的速度工作,如果你想处理视频帧,可以使用包装器。此外,还有一些示例,您可以在其中将 Java OpenCV 代码与 JNI 代码混合使用,从而使您的算法更快。

遗憾的是,这些示例是在 Eclipse 项目上制作的,但它们并不难合并到 Android studio 项目中。

希望这些参考有用

干杯。